A pair of easy chairs in elm by Fritz Hansen, 1940’s
A pair of easy chairs in elm wood with rounded, open frames and softly curved armrests. The chairs have removable seat cushions upholstered in a blue fabric, finished with blue and white striped piping that follows the circular seat shape. The light wooden frames create an airy, balanced structure that contrasts with the saturated textile. This model, titled Model 1774, was designed by Aage Herman Olsen in 1945 and manufactured by Fritz Hansen in 1948. Presented together, the chairs form a playful and cohesive pair with a clear visual rhythm.
